May 26
Il protocollo SNMP è una soluzione più vecchio per il controllo remoto e la gestione delle informazioni relative alle risorse di rete. È possibile utilizzare questo protocollo in PHP per recuperare informazioni su una risorsa remota in rete. Il linguaggio PHP include librerie per il protocollo SNMP per interrogare a distanza di un oggetto e recuperare un elenco di valori di dati riguardanti i servizi e le configurazioni della risorsa di rete.
1 Fare clic destro sul file PHP che si desidera modificare e selezionare "Apri con". Clicca vostro editor preferito PHP.
2 Utilizzare la seguente funzione per la connessione al dispositivo in rete:
$ Device = snmpget ( "127.0.0.1", "pubblico", "system.SysContact.0");
Sostituire l'indirizzo IP con l'indirizzo IP del dispositivo che si desidera accedere.
3 Recupero informazioni sul dispositivo. Il codice seguente ottiene un elenco di dati dal dispositivo:
$ Dati snmp_read_mib ( './ MIB.txt');
Sostituire "MIB.txt" con il file MIB che contiene le informazioni SNMP sul dispositivo.
4 Stampare l'output alla finestra del browser. Il codice seguente stampa i dati al browser per la tua recensione:
print_r (snmprealwalk ( '$ data,' senza-MIB :: tabella ');